Spanakopita Puff Pastry Swirls Recipe

  • Prep Time: 20 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 40 minutes
  • Yield: 12 swirls

Description

Delicious and flaky Spanakopita Puff Pastry Swirls filled with a savory mixture of spinach, feta, and Parmesan cheese. These Greek-inspired appetizers are easy to make and perfect for parties or a tasty snack, baked to golden perfection with a crispy puff pastry exterior.


Ingredients

Scale

Filling

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 5 ounces frozen spinach, thawed and squeezed dry
  • 1/2 cup crumbled feta cheese
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 egg, lightly beaten
  • 1/4 teaspoon dried dill or fresh chopped dill
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

Pastry & Finishing

  • 1 sheet puff pastry, thawed
  • 1 egg, for egg wash


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prepare for baking the swirls.
  2. Sauté Aromatics: In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Sauté the finely chopped onion until soft and translucent, about 3 to 4 minutes. Add minced garlic and cook for an additional 1 minute. Remove from heat and let cool slightly.
  3. Prepare Filling: In a medium bowl, combine the thawed and squeezed spinach, sautéed onion and garlic, crumbled feta, grated Parmesan, one beaten egg, dill, salt, and black pepper. Mix everything thoroughly to create a uniform filling.
  4. Roll Out Puff Pastry: On a lightly floured surface, unroll the thawed puff pastry sheet. Evenly spread the spinach and cheese filling over the pastry, leaving a 1/2-inch border around the edges for sealing.
  5. Form Logs and Slice: Starting from the long edge, roll the pastry tightly into a log shape. Using a sharp knife, slice the rolled log into 1/2-inch rounds to form individual swirls. Place these swirls flat on the prepared baking sheet, spaced slightly apart.
  6. Apply Egg Wash: Beat the second egg and brush the tops of each swirl generously to give them a golden, glossy finish when baked.
  7. Bake: Bake the puff pastry swirls in the preheated oven for 18 to 22 minutes, or until they are puffed up and golden brown.
  8. Cool and Serve: Allow the swirls to cool slightly on the baking sheet before serving warm or at room temperature.

Notes

  • Serve these swirls warm or at room temperature for best flavor and texture.
  • Make ahead: Prepare and slice the swirls, then freeze before baking. Bake from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the baking time.
  • Ensure spinach is well drained to avoid soggy pastry.
  • For a dairy-free variation, substitute feta and Parmesan with plant-based cheese alternatives.
